Tar protection for millennia. Traditionally, tar is extracted through dry distillation of resinous pine wood in tar pits or smaller coal kilns. The quality of the tar is determined by color, consistency, and drying ability. Our tar is of the highest quality and comes from Claessons Wood Tar. When tar is applied, it is beneficial to heat it to achieve better penetration and become more fluid. 1 liter of tar is sufficient for about 2-4 square meters for the first coat. For the second coat, if needed, 1 liter is sufficient for about 4-8 square meters. Roslagsmahogny is a mixture of equal parts tar, linseed oil, and balsam turpentine. It is more user-friendly, penetrates better, dries faster, and is easy to pigment, also covering more area than just tar. Läs mindre
